METEOR
(Latour-Marliac – 1909)
Météor is a bold water lily, capable of illuminating any body of water with its large cherry-red flowers. The outer petals, delicately shaded in white, create a fascinating chromatic contrast that enhances its scenic presence. Perfect for those who want to add a touch of vivacity to their pond, combining tradition and timeless beauty.
Characteristics:
- Bold Flowers : Large cherry red corollas, embellished with elegant white tips.
- Unique Contrast : The alternation between deep red and light shades makes each bloom a real spectacle.
- History and Tradition : Coming from the art of Latour-Marliac (1909), a prestigious choice for water lily enthusiasts.
- Versatile and Reliable : Ideal for ponds of various sizes, it adds a touch of class and color.

MURILLO
(Latour-Marliac – 1910)
Murillo is a water lily with a remarkable visual impact, ideal for those who love intense nuances and fascinating contrasts. Its flowers, star-shaped and medium in size, have a dark mauve dotted with carmine, more intense in the center, while the outer petals remain white. This play of colors gives a unique scenic effect, perfect for embellishing any body of water.
Characteristics
- Medium-sized star-shaped flowers : A balance of shapes that makes the plant particularly elegant.
- Chromatic Contrast : The dark mauve with carmine flecks intensifies towards the centre, framed by the white of the outer petals.
- Variety of Historical Charm : Born from the Latour-Marliac tradition (1910), it expresses all the prestige of a vintage selection.
- Perfect for Ornamental Ponds : Ideal for those who want to create a focal point of rare beauty in their water garden.

Titan
The variety "Titan" stands out for its abundant flowering of purple-red flowers, which create a beautiful accent of color in the garden.
Main features:
- Flowers: Abundant and of an intense purple-red color, they offer an extraordinary visual impact and add vivacity and chromatic richness to the environment.
- Leaves: The leaves have diffuse shades of purple, which complement the majestic appearance of the flowers and contribute to a harmonious decorative effect.
- Stems: The stems of the plant are strongly heliotropic, that is, they have the ability to follow the movement of the sun in the sky. This characteristic makes them particularly dynamic, with the flowers orienting themselves towards the light to maximize photosynthesis and maintain an illuminated position.
Overall Effect: "Titán" offers a breathtaking visual experience with its vivid purple flowers and foliage hues, while blending harmoniously with its surroundings. The heliotropic stems add an interactive and lively element, making this plant a spectacular addition to sunny gardens and outdoor spaces that benefit from full sun exposure.
